Keyword research
Keyword research is the process by which determines the keywords that are relevant for your business and the market you want to target. It is an essential part of your local search SEO strategy as it assists you in optimizing your blog and site for specific terms.
Local search is a growing part of the online marketing industry, and if you wish for your business to be noticed by people searching for your product or service in your local area, conducting keyword research is key. It will help you rank in the "map pack" results for search results in your local area, and it can increase your conversion rates.
During keyword research, you should concentrate on long-tail and transactional keywords that bring in the right type of customers. These keywords may be lower in search volume, but they can bring in high-quality leads that will convert faster than broad keywords.
To start keyword research it is best to first create your list of keywords that relate to your business. For instance, if for instance you manage a restaurant in Houston you could include the words "restaurant in Houston," "food in Houston," and "Houston restaurants."
You can also check out the websites of your competition to see the keywords they use to draw customers to their areas. This will give you an idea of the keywords you should utilize on your site pages and in your pay-per-click advertisements.
It is also essential to find keywords that have local intent, meaning that the person searching for them has a specific area in mind. This could be a neighborhood, suburb, or even a city. Google lets you easily check the local intent of a keyword.
After you've created the list of keywords relevant to your company, you're now able to get them to rank. This can be accomplished using tools for research on keywords, such as Google Keyword Planner and SEMrush. You can also do this by doing it manually by looking up keywords on your competition's websites and analysing their content.
On-page optimization
On-page optimization is an essential part of any SEO strategy and is the process of optimizing a website in order to make it more visible in search results. It can involve a range of techniques, such as images optimized for on-page content, and internal links.
On-page optimization allows you to increase the likelihood of your website appearing in Map Pack or in organic local search results for relevant keywords in your business's service area. This is a crucial factor in bringing your business's name to the forefront online and turning potential customers into paying clients.
A key part of on-page optimization in local search is to ensure that your business's details are consistent across all platforms. This includes your company's name, addresses, phone numbers, and email. The NAP is the information that search engines use to determine your location, so make sure that your information is correct and easy to find.
Another important thing to think about when optimizing your website for local search is implementing schema markup for your website. This will assist Google organize your data and include it in relevant local search results.
Schema can be extremely helpful for local searches because it makes your site more visible to people searching for you. Schema integration on your website is as easy as adding HTML code to your pages.
It is also possible to add it to your Google My Business profile (GMB) and can significantly impact your local search ranking. It can also boost your GMB profile's visibility on Google Maps, which can be a powerful source of new local traffic for your business.
It's recommended to keep your NAP listed on your Yelp, Facebook, and Yext profiles. These citations help search engines connect the pieces to your online puzzle and expose your NAP information to as many people as is possible.

Off-page optimization
Off-page SEO is the method of optimizing your website content, content, and social media sites for search engines. It includes all the actions that happen outside of your website, such as creating backlinks, engaging on social media and guest blogging.
Off-page SEO is therefore an an important part of your overall local search strategy. It will help your website rank higher in search engines and attract more people to your site.
Link building is one of the most well-known offpage SEO methods. This method involves constructing links with reliable sources in order to boost the visibility of your site and increase its position. The goal of this strategy is to establish your domain as a reliable and authoritative source for your target keywords.

Another important off-page optimization method is to create content that appeals to your customers' needs and interests. This content could contain information about your business and news.
Creating these types of content can be time-consuming as well as costly but it's worth it in the end to boost your search engine rankings. In addition, these pieces of content can be found by Google and shared on other websites to promote your brand.
Infographics can be an excellent option for your business to be advertised online. Infographics are visual representations of data that are easy to comprehend by the general public. Plus, they can be used on mobile devices, which could help your rankings in local search results.
An excellent infographic should include high-quality images and a clear, concise layout. It should also be optimized for the device it will be used on. Search engines won't display your infographic properly when it's not optimized.
In the area of local search it's particularly important to optimize for the map pack and regular organic listings. These two elements are frequently at the top of Google's search results for local searches, and they get many clicks.
To be able to rank highly in the map pack, your business must have a Google My Business page with an accurate address and NAP. In the page's title you should include your business's categories as as relevant keywords.
Link building
If you're hoping to rank high in Google for local results, you must have a strong link building strategy. This strategy will help you get more organic traffic to your site and also attract the right type of web users who are interested in your products and services.
The best way to build relationships is to create valuable content that others can share with their networks. This could be detailed lists, instructional videos and infographics, as well as well-curated curated content.
Local marketing is another method to establish links that are of high quality. This could include giveaways or promotions that target local audiences.
Your social media accounts can be utilized to promote your business. This can help you generate links and increase brand recognition. For instance, posting about local events or special offers to your social media pages can boost your visibility among potential customers, and increase the credibility of your brand.
You can also leverage your social media accounts to discover and collaborate with local businesses, organizations or other groups that have an audience that is similar to your own. These partners can help you gain valuable local connections and grow your business.
To begin with link building, you must prepare a list of key words that people might seek when searching for your particular type of products or services. These keywords should be relevant to your area and the products or services that you offer.
Find local websites with a high Domain Authority. These websites are authoritative and can help you get valuable backlinks.
